Bobby Lee and Matt Jones discuss the struggles of the acting industry, with Jones sharing his frustration over lack of roles and the dominance of "rich kids" in Hollywood. They bond over their shared dislike of long-form improv and the competitive nature of shows like Kill Tony. The conversation also covers their experiences with wealthy celebrities, the decline of network television, and Jones’s candid take on why he feels undervalued in the current entertainment landscape.
